Frequently Asked Questions

What are typical salary ranges by seniority in flexible scheduling roles?
Entry‑level shift workers earn $15–$22 per hour ($30,000–$45,000 annually). Mid‑level scheduling coordinators command $20–$30 per hour ($42,000–$63,000). Senior shift managers or workforce supervisors see $30–$45 per hour ($63,000–$94,000). High‑tier operations managers can reach $45–$70 per hour ($94,000–$146,000).
What skills and certifications are required for flexible scheduling positions?
Proficiency with scheduling software such as When I Work, Deputy, Sling, or Shiftboard is essential. Candidates should demonstrate data analysis skills, time‑tracking accuracy, and knowledge of labor‑law compliance. Certifications like Certified Shift Manager (CSM), OSHA safety training, or HIPAA for healthcare scheduling add credibility. Strong communication, conflict resolution, and digital collaboration tools (Slack, Teams) are also critical.
Is remote work available in flexible scheduling roles?
Many scheduling coordinator and remote customer support positions can be performed from home, leveraging cloud‑based workforce management platforms. Shift manager roles often require on‑site presence for real‑time oversight, but hybrid options exist, especially in tech support and logistics hubs. Remote positions demand high self‑discipline, reliable internet, and proficiency with virtual collaboration tools.
What career progression paths exist for flexible scheduling professionals?
A common trajectory starts with a scheduling assistant or intern, moves to coordinator, then to shift supervisor or fleet manager. From there, professionals may advance to workforce operations manager, director of workforce analytics, or HR technology lead. Upskilling in predictive analytics, AI scheduling, and business intelligence can open executive roles in workforce optimization.
What industry trends are shaping the future of flexible scheduling?
Automation of shift planning using AI and predictive analytics is reducing manual roster work. Real‑time labor‑market data feeds into platforms like Deputy, allowing dynamic overtime pricing. The gig economy fuels on‑demand shift roles, while remote‑first companies expand part‑time, flexible options. Integration of scheduling with payroll and compliance modules is becoming standard, improving transparency and efficiency.
